In this episode, I welcome fellow podcaster and newly-minted half-marathoner DJ Tricey Trice (A Trice Rias-Thompson). She shares the spontaneous decision-making process that led her to take on a half marathon, her solo training regime, and the mental and physical challenges she overcame to complete it. The discussion also touches on the importance of nutrition, the benefits of running groups, and the unique experience of participating in the Nike After Dark Half Marathon event.
Shifting gears, DJ Tricey Trice is also the host of LA Sparks Weekly, so I had to ask her about her thoughts on her favorite team this season. We dived into an in-depth analysis of the WNBA, discussing team dynamics, key players, and the current season’s surprises and challenges. Part race report, part WNBA season analysis, part comedy show.
